摘要

A stem of a ship is provided to stabilize and simplify a structure thereof with structural strength maintained by installing a ring frame inside of the stern of the ship. A stem(10) of a ship includes an outer plate(11) and a structure member(12). The outer plate is formed to reduce resistance of fluid. The structure member is installed inside the outer plate and includes vertical members(40), horizontal members(41), and a reinforcement matters(42). The vertical members and the horizontal members partition the stem and maintain structural strength of the stem. The reinforcement matters are installed widthwise of the stem and reinforce the structural strength of the stem.
